mediengestalter.info
FAQ :: Mitgliederliste :: MGi Team

Willkommen auf dem Portal für Mediengestalter

Aktuelles Datum und Uhrzeit: Fr 26.04.2024 18:43 Benutzername: Passwort: Auto-Login

Thema: vereinfachen von nem script vom 17.06.2007


Neues Thema eröffnen   Neue Antwort erstellen MGi Foren-Übersicht -> Multimedia -> vereinfachen von nem script
Autor Nachricht
Flipkick
Threadersteller

Dabei seit: 15.05.2003
Ort: Frankfurt am Main
Alter: 41
Geschlecht: Männlich
Verfasst So 17.06.2007 22:51
Titel

vereinfachen von nem script

Antworten mit Zitat Zum Seitenanfang

Hallo,

kann mir mal jmd verraten wie ich diese Funktion vereinfachen kann ??

on(press){
_root.gal1._x=_root.gal1thumbx;
_root.gal1._y=_root.gal1thumby;
_root.gal2._alpha = 0;
_root.gal3._alpha = 0;
_root.gal4._alpha = 0;
_root.gal5._alpha = 0;
}

ich müsste jetzt dieses script 80x schreiben und wenn was geändert wird habe ich ein klein-aufwendiges Prob. Ich glaub es ist auch vol einfach aber irgendwie fehlt mir grad, der nötige Schritt.

Kann man das asl Funktion irgendwie auf root auslagern, dass ich nur auf der obersten Ebene die Variablen deklarieren kann ???

danke seb
  View user's profile Private Nachricht senden Website dieses Benutzers besuchen
rob

Dabei seit: 11.12.2003
Ort: ~/
Alter: 46
Geschlecht: Männlich
Verfasst Mo 18.06.2007 00:52
Titel

Antworten mit Zitat Zum Seitenanfang

Zitat:
ich müsste jetzt dieses script 80x schreiben

Warum?

Was genau willst du machen?

Man braucht eine Funktion nicht 80mal zu schreiben, sondern nur ein einziges Mal.
Gib der Funktion einen Namen. Dann kannst du sie so oft aufrufen, wie du willst.

Oder meintest du, daß in deiner Funktion noch 80 Zuweisungen stattfinden sollen?
Dann mache das mit einer Schleife.
  View user's profile Private Nachricht senden
Anzeige
Anzeige
Flipkick
Threadersteller

Dabei seit: 15.05.2003
Ort: Frankfurt am Main
Alter: 41
Geschlecht: Männlich
Verfasst Mo 18.06.2007 08:18
Titel

Antworten mit Zitat Zum Seitenanfang

Hallo, das mit der Funktion zuweisen hatte ich auch schon gemacht:

aus:

on(press){
_root.gal1._x=_root.gal1thumbx;
_root.gal1._y=_root.gal1thumby;
_root.gal2._alpha = 0;
_root.gal3._alpha = 0;
_root.gal4._alpha = 0;
_root.gal5._alpha = 0;
}

wurde:

on(press){
test();
}

und auf Root lag:

function test ()
{
_root.gal1._x=_root.gal1thumbx;
_root.gal1._y=_root.gal1thumby;
_root.gal2._alpha = 0;
_root.gal3._alpha = 0;
_root.gal4._alpha = 0;
_root.gal5._alpha = 0;
}

wo ist denn da der schreibfehler ? oder liegt das vlt daran, dass der Button auf einem unterem MC liegt und ich die funktion aber auf Root habe ?!?!?

danke Sebö
  View user's profile Private Nachricht senden Website dieses Benutzers besuchen
 
Ähnliche Themen php script vereinfachen?
php-Code vereinfachen
Logo-Platzierung vereinfachen
SQL Abfrage vereinfachen (Kategorien)
script deaktivieren mit einem andere script?
Action Script 2 oder Action Script 3
Neues Thema eröffnen   Neue Antwort erstellen
MGi Foren-Übersicht -> Multimedia


Du kannst keine Beiträge in dieses Forum schreiben.
Du kannst auf Beiträge in diesem Forum nicht antworten.
Du kannst an Umfragen in diesem Forum nicht mitmachen.